- Learning Xvisor®
- Xvisor® is an open-source type-1 hypervisor, which aims at providing a monolithic, light-weight, portable, and flexible virtualization solution. It provides a high performance and low memory foot print virtualization solution for ARMv5, ARMv6, ARMv7a, ARMv7a-ve, ARMv8a, x86_64, and other CPU architectures.

- Learning Linux-VServer
- Linux-VServer provides virtualization for GNU/Linux systems. This is accomplished by kernel level isolation. It allows to run multiple virtual units at once. Those units are sufficiently isolated to guarantee the required security, but utilize available resources efficiently, as they run on the same kernel.
